
It’s not just humans who love to worry. New research at the University of Bordeaux has demonstrated that crayfish subject to high stress will develop anxiety-like symptoms – but human medicines can cure them of it.
The study is one of many in recent years to highlight the potential for emotional intelligence in non-humans. The researchers, from the Aquitaine Institute for Cognitive and Integrative Neuroscience (INCIA), managed to induce a state of anxiety in the fish, which they subsequently cured by administering drugs.
